Left fielder Elijah Dukes left the yard and had 2 RBI at Ganzee Stadium where
the Saint Gabriel Apostles beat the Burmese Blood Monkeys in 10 innings 6 to
5.
The score was knotted at 4 after nine innings. Saint Gabriel won it in the
10th inning. David Eckstein led off and started the attack as he banged out
a single, and an error was also committed. Two outs later Mike Jacobs
stepped in and he was walked intentionally. Dukes then delivered a single
scoring a run. Joe Mauer was up next and he slapped a base-hit scoring the
final run of the inning. Burmese had 15 hits in the game while Saint Gabriel
had 12, but Saint Gabriel had the more timely hits.
Kevin Gregg(3-3) picked up the victory, allowing 1 run in 1 and 1/3 innings.
Chris Capuano(0-3) was the losing pitcher in relief. The win by Saint
Gabriel was very good news as they had been 2-8 of late. Now their seasonal
record improves to 24-30. With this loss, Burmese has a 4-6 record of late,
27-27, worst in the division overall.
